From Bedside Insight to Boardroom Vision: The Leadership Story Behind Hyderabad Home Care

February 18, Hyderabad (Telangana): In a healthcare ecosystem often shaped by operational scale and financial targets, Hyderabad Home Care represents a different model one led by clinical expertise, strategic discipline, and uncompromising trust.

Founded by Sachin Kamireddy, a trained nurse and healthcare entrepreneur, the organisation emerged from personal experience rather than market opportunity alone. During his father’s battle with severe kidney complications and heart failure, Sachin witnessed firsthand the structural gaps in home-based caregiving particularly in reliability, accountability, and emotional intelligence.

That experience evolved into a strategic vision: to build a nurse-led, quality-assured home healthcare institution where ethics would precede expansion.

A Clinician at the Helm in a Management-Driven Sector

Established in 2018, the organisation initially operated under the name Ayush Home Care. As the brand matured, a name overlap with the Government of India’s AYUSH initiative prompted a deliberate rebranding to Hyderabad Home Care a move that reinforced clarity, regional identity, and long-term positioning.

Unlike many agencies structured around management-first models, Hyderabad Home Care operates under clinical leadership. Strategic decisions are guided by medical protocols, patient safety frameworks, and structured nurse governance systems rather than purely commercial targets.

Strengthening this foundation is Anitta Syriac, a senior nurse from Kerala, a region globally recognised for its nursing excellence and Sachin’s wife. Together, they have developed a care culture defined by discipline, discretion, and precision.

Premium Care for Complex & High-Profile Families

Hyderabad Home Care has built specialised expertise in handling sensitive, high-risk medical cases within home environments.

The organisation has managed care for:

  • Extremely premature newborns weighing as little as 600 grams
  • Complex neonatal cases including multiple births
  • Post-ICU recovery patients requiring structured monitoring at home

Over time, a focused Premium & VVIP Baby Care vertical was developed, incorporating refined caregiver-matching protocols that consider not only clinical competence but also emotional maturity, family dynamics, and discretion.

Today, the institution has served over 5,000 families, including more than 250 VIP and VVIP clients ranging from senior bureaucrats and judicial members to business leaders and international families. Much of this growth has been referral-driven, underscoring sustained trust rather than aggressive promotion.

Building Scale Without Compromising Governance

Supporting this scale is a network of over 690 registered freelance nurses, each carefully vetted for clinical skill, communication ability, and ethical conduct.

Importantly, Hyderabad Home Care has positioned nurses as long-term professional partners rather than transactional resources. Structured onboarding, accountability mechanisms, and quality monitoring systems form the backbone of operations.

For the founder, growth is not measured by expansion alone. It is measured by:

  • Zero major clinical errors
  • Minimal negative feedback
  • High nurse retention
  • Long-term client relationships

His guiding principle remains:
“Trust is greater than money. A commitment, once given, becomes a responsibility.”

Recognition Beyond Commercial Success

In September 2024, Sachin Kamireddy was honoured with the Outstanding Young Person Award by Junior Chamber International (JCI), Secunderabad Paradise, under the category of Humanitarian & Voluntary Leadership.

The recognition highlighted ethical leadership and social contribution — reinforcing Hyderabad Home Care’s positioning as a purpose-driven enterprise balancing compassion with structured growth.

Strategic Expansion: The Mumbai Vision

Looking ahead, Hyderabad Home Care is preparing for a strategic expansion into Mumbai, with a refined focus on ultra-premium baby care and specialised nursing services for high-profile families.

The long-term objective is clear: to establish one of India’s most trusted, governance-driven, premium home healthcare brands particularly in neonatal and high-risk care segments.

Through both Hyderabad Home Care and the Kamireddy Foundation, the broader mission remains consistent, elevating home healthcare standards in India from informal service delivery to structured, trust-led systems.
